Hospital and Surgery Costs. Total health care spending in America was approximately $3.5-trillion in 2017 and about 32% of that amount — or $1.1-trillion — was spent on hospital services. Hospital costs averaged $3,949 per day and each https://docs.google.com/spreadsheets/d/1wyK4CyNHIuSydR9a4w5V0JSHuStzrXnrdl8sZwH299M/edit?usp=sharing hospital stay cost an average of $15,734.

What is OPD limit?

OPD Treatments: OPD or Outpatient Department treatment refers to those cases when the treatment and diagnosis of the ailment is done on advice of a medical practitioner or doctor, by simply visiting their clinic or any other consultation room.
